H-M-H / Weylus

Use your tablet as graphic tablet/touch screen on your computer.
Other
6.88k stars 273 forks source link

Point to Point Connection (Wifi direct) for better FPS #186

Open Papermanzero opened 1 year ago

Papermanzero commented 1 year ago

First things first, weylus is an awesome project! The only thing I recognised is that the framerate is about 20FPS. In order to improve the framerate i would like to suggest to connect weylus directly with a host. especially for streaming of 60FPS content it would be good to achieve at least 30FPS which could be achieved via point to point connection.

Maybe using the router to establish the connection between the devices and then switch to WiFi Direct via the Weylus UI.

lukebrowell commented 1 year ago

Have you considered setting your computer up as a WiFi hotspot itself, so see if it is any faster than connecting via your router's WiFi Access Point? It might be worth doing this first before exploring further.

Papermanzero commented 1 year ago

That could be a good test. But those tests should be performed from different set ups. Miracast and The property WiiU Wifi Streaming shows that you can reach up to 60 FPS with point to point. However the setup is important (Wifi 11.ac and 11.ax

gabmert commented 8 months ago

Have you tried cable? Either via the adb (see the readme) or via a ethernet adapter to your phone? This should result in the highest possible connection bandwidth without the need for weylus to do network configuration

Papermanzero commented 8 months ago

Yes of course. The features of weylus are amazing. This is just a proposal to make weylus better. The WiFi Direct possibility is a great way to overcome bottlenecks from routers and the environment